Description She stole his Christmas dinner and left him with a kiss. Dan Tollinger is having a bad Christmas. His wife lost her battle with cancer and he's finding it hard to manage his two sons. Busy with his shop he has little time left for them, so having a woman around to keep an eye on them seems like an ideal solution. She hopes he won't know her Tonya needs premises to run her business after her bakery got damaged in a fire. With a son to bring up on her own, the sensible option is to accept Dan's job offer to housekeep while putting her business back on the track. Neither counted on the unexpected warmth and awareness that sprang up between them. Would it be wise to let it kindle to desire and then something more? Especially when his sons are not ready to accept her in his life.
